Step 1: Try To Recover Your Account Login Information
To recover your old minecraft account, start by going to the official minecraft website and navigating to the login page. From there, click on the “forgot password? ” Link and enter your email address associated with your account. Follow the instructions provided to reset your password.
It’s important to make sure you have access to the email address associated with your account to ensure a smooth recovery process. Following these steps should help you recover your old minecraft account without much trouble.

Step 3: Provide Proof Of Ownership
To prove that you’re the owner of your old minecraft account, you’ll need to provide some pieces of information. That includes your transaction id from when you purchased minecraft and your last known login date and location. You should also provide receipts or other payment proofs and personal details like your full name and date of birth.
This is to verify that you are indeed the rightful owner of the account. It’s essential to gather all the necessary evidence to make the process more manageable and faster for you. So, always keep that in mind and don’t hesitate to provide everything required.

What Should I Do If I Forgot My Old Minecraft Account Password?
Visit the official minecraft website and click on the “forgot password” link. Enter your email address and follow the steps to reset your password. If you don’t remember your email address, contact minecraft customer support for assistance.
Can I Still Access My Old Minecraft Account If I No Longer Have Access To The Original Email Address Used To Set Up The Account?
Yes, you can still access your old minecraft account if you no longer have access to the original email address used to set up the account. Contact minecraft customer support and they will assist you in changing the email address associated with the account.
